John Donne Strikes Again

Dark clouds: emptiness abides. White clouds: emptiness abides. See yourself through these windows of the world. What are you waiting for? Remember, we stopped using 'for whom' years ago. Yet, John Donne still rings true. Just ask. "Yes, I say. Just simply ask to toll the bell, for the bell is you, ringing, ringing simply you."
